Residential Ramp Installation in Kansas City, KS
Residential ramp installation services provide customized solutions to improve accessibility around homes, making it easier to navigate stairs, porches, or uneven terrain. These projects typically involve constructing or installing ramps for entryways, garages, or decks to accommodate individuals with mobility challenges, those using wheelchairs, or anyone needing assistance with carrying heavy items. Homeowners often seek this service to enhance safety, comply with accessibility needs, or prepare for future mobility requirements, ensuring that their property remains functional and welcoming for all visitors.
Before requesting residential ramp installation, property owners should consider the specific locations where ramps are needed, the type of ramp suitable for the property's layout, and any local building codes or regulations that may apply. It’s also helpful to think about the materials preferred, the desired length and slope of the ramp, and how the installation will integrate with the existing landscape or architecture. Having a clear understanding of these factors can facilitate planning and ensure the project meets safety and accessibility goals effectively.

Residential Ramp Installation Questions
What types of residential ramps are available? There are various options including portable, modular, and custom-built ramps to suit different property layouts and accessibility needs.
How do I know if a ramp is suitable for my property? Factors like the property's terrain, doorway height, and intended use help determine the most appropriate ramp type and design.
What materials are commonly used for residential ramps? Common materials include aluminum, wood, and composite materials, chosen for durability and safety.
Are there specific regulations to consider for residential ramp installation? Local building codes and accessibility standards should be followed to ensure safety and compliance during installation.
